首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

apache ab压力测试学习

今天我们专门来介绍ababapache自带压力测试工具。ab非常实用,它不仅可以对apache服务器进行网站访问压力测试,也可以对或其它类型服务器进行压力测试。...2.ab原理 ab是apachebench命令缩写。 ab原理:ab命令会创建多个并发访问线程,模拟多个访问者同时对某一URL地址进行访问。...它测试目标是基于URL,因此,它既可以用来测试apache负载压力,也可以测试nginx、lighthttp、tomcat、IIS等其它Web服务器压力。...3.ab安装 ab安装非常简单,如果是源码安装apache的话,那就更简单了。apache安装完毕后ab命令存放在apache安装目录bin目录下。...如下: /usr/local/apache2/bin 可在apache官网下载安装包,也可以访问我提取好链接下载http://pan.baidu.com/s/1eRVqgBC 4.使用 将ab.exe

1K10

使用Apacheab进行压力测试

概述 abapache自带压力测试工具,当安装完apache时候,就可以在bin下面找到ab然后进行apache 负载压力测试。...后台测试开发中,常用压力测试服务,php一般选择xampp,下载地址:点击打开链接,java后台,如果你选用apacheapache http自带了ab压力测试工具,地址:点击打开链接。...下面以apache http server介绍ab压力测试。 安装 下载:http://httpd.apache.org/ ? ?...程序就在E:\Apache24\bin中(这里可以将httpd -k install,把apache安装成windows后台服务),这里我们直接使用ab命令测试 ?...ab其他命令 格式: ./ab [options] [http://]hostname[:port]/path Ab命令参数注释:   -n    #指定在测试会话中所执行请求个数。

1.6K100
您找到你想要的搜索结果了吗?
是的
没有找到

Apache ab并发负载压力测试

ab命令原理 Apacheab命令模拟多线程并发请求,测试服务器负载压力,也可以测试nginx、lighthttp、IIS等其它Web服务器压力。...ab命令对发出负载计算机要求很低,既不会占用很多CPU,也不会占用太多内存,但却会给目标服务器造成巨大负载,因此是某些DDOS攻击之必备良药,老少皆宜。自己使用也须谨慎。...C=M;O=A 找到 httpd-2.2.21-win32-x86-no_ssl.msi 参数文档: http://httpd.apache.org/docs/2.2/programs/ab.html...运行: 在Windows系统下,打开cmd命令行窗口,定位到apache安装目录bin目录下 cd C:\Program Files (x86)\Apache Software Foundation...\Apache2.2\bin 键入命令: ab -n 800 -c 800 http://192.168.0.10/ (-n发出800个请求,-c模拟800并发,相当800人同时访问,后面是测试url

1.4K30

apache-ab 并发负载压力测试

性能测试工具目前最常见有以下几种:ab、http_load、webbench、siege abapache自带压力测试工具。...ab非常实用,它不仅可以对apache服务器进行网站访问压力测试,也可以对或其它类型服务器进行压力测试。比如nginx、tomcat、IIS等。...一、ab 原理(apachebench命令缩写) ab命令会创建多个并发访问线程,模拟多个访问者同时对某一URL地址进行访问。...它测试目标是基于URL,因此,它既可以用来测试apache负载压力,也可以测试nginx、lighthttp、tomcat、IIS等其它Web服务器压力 ab命令对发出负载计算机要求很低,它既不会占用很高...执行 make install 安装 which ab 查看安装位置 which ab ③ 不想安装Apache 但是想使用 ab 命令时可以直接安装 Apache 工具包 http-tools

1.7K30

使用Apache ab进行http性能测试

Mac自带了Apache环境 打开“终端(terminal)”,输入 sudo apachectl -v,(可能需要输入机器秘密)。如下显示Apache版本 ?...其位于“/Library(资源库)/WebServer/Documents/”下,这就是Apache默认根目录。 Apache安装目录在:/etc/apache2/,etc默认是隐藏。.../configure (3) make && make install (4) sudo cp support/ab /usr/sbin 4. ab -n 1000 -c 10 http://localhost...:3000/ 最后这个斜杠不能少 这个ab -n1000 -c10 http://localhost:3000/命令,在window系统下,需要先用cd命令定位到你apache安装目录bin文件夹。...ab参数说明 -n 需要执行请求次数 -c 并发数量 -t 等待返回最长时间 -b TCP收发缓冲区大小,单位(byte) -p 使用post (同时需要定义-T参数) -u 使用put (同时需要定义

82432

压力测试工具:apache bench(ab)

这时候,我们就可以用到apache压力测试工具了,apache bench简称ab 安装 linux  yum -y install httpd-tools  //centos  apt-get install... apache2-utils //ubuntu  ab -V #查看版本 windows windows只需要安装apache,就自带ab工具 ?...,尤其是Requests per second 参数,它确定了服务器秒并发能力 ab常用参数配置 命令格式 ab [-命令命令参数] 请求地址 最后请求地址不能直接为单域名(http://www.php20...-C 添加cookie -C "cookie1=cookie1,cookie2=cookie2"  -w 以html表格元素显示ab测试结果: ?...,但是并不能实现复杂测试条件判断,例如post数据异常,ab测试工具是不能够判断数据是否异常 本文为仙士可原创文章,转载无需和我联系,但请注明来自仙士可博客www.php20.cn

4.5K30

Apache性能测试工具ab安装使用

性能测试工具目前最常见有以下几种:ab、http_load、webbench、siege abapache自带压力测试工具。...二、ab安装 ab安装非常简单,如果是源码安装apache的话,那就更简单了。apache安装完毕后ab命令存放在apache安装目录bin目录下。...如下: /usr/local/apache2/bin 如果apache 是通过yumRPM包方式安装的话,ab命令默认存放在/usr/bin目录下。...如下:which ab 注意:如果不想安装apache但是又想使用ab命令的话,我们可以直接安装apache工具包httpd-tools。...注意以上是在linux平台下进行安装,如果是windows平台下,我们也可以下载对应apache版本进行安装。 三、ab参数说明 有关ab命令使用,我们可以通过帮助命令进行查看。

1.7K10

使用Apache Server ab进行web请求压力测试

直到遇到一个又一个问题时候才回头过来重新修改。这就是没有测试悲剧。因此,在今后代码中一定要尝试着去写测试,去做测试。...发现Apache Server下有个工具ab可以进行并发请求,正好有个需求想要知道并发下访问情况。...然后是选择镜像和版本,不要选择德国: ? 2.安装 我这是买椟还珠游戏,不想去了解Apache功能,只想要ab。所以直接解压,然后在bin目录找到ab就可以了: ?...3.测试 输入ab就可以看到帮助文档 D:\Java\httpd-2.4.23-x64-vc14\Apache24\bin>ab ab: wrong number of arguments Usage:...\bin> 举例: D:\Java\httpd-2.4.23-x64-vc14\Apache24\bin>ab -n 20 -c 10 localhost:8080/user/all -n表示一共请求20

84970

ApacheApache ab压力测试工具Window下载和用法详解

abapache自带网站压力测试工具。 使用起来非常简单和方便。 不仅仅是可以apache服务器进行网站访问压力测试,还可以对其他类型服务器进行压力测试。...接下来就是测试了 开始测试 如果你需要在命令行任意路径下可以输入ab测试,可以把bin目录路径加到环境变量path中去 我是在bin目录下打开命令行 注意,下面的是错误,因为需要在域名后加上.../path ab -n 100 -c 10 http://www.baidu.com 报错信息如下: ab: invalid URL Usage: ab [options] [http://]hostname...s为path,表示指定测试地址,不指定可能会报”ab: invalid url” 错误....另外还有-t 表示多少s内并发和请求 测试出来数据如下: D:\apacheab\Apache24\bin>ab -n 100 -c 10 http://www.baidu.com/s This is

1.2K10

Apache ab并发负载压力测试实现方法

ab命令原理 Apacheab命令模拟多线程并发请求,测试服务器负载压力,也可以测试nginx、lighthttp、IIS等其它Web服务器压力。...ab命令对发出负载计算机要求很低,既不会占用很多CPU,也不会占用太多内存,但却会给目标服务器造成巨大负载,因此是某些DDOS攻击之必备良药,老少皆宜。自己使用也须谨慎。...C=M;O=A 找到 httpd-2.2.21-win32-x86-no_ssl.msi 参数文档: http://httpd.apache.org/docs/2.2/programs/ab.html...运行: 在Windows系统下,打开cmd命令行窗口,定位到apache安装目录bin目录下 cd C:\Program Files (x86)\Apache Software Foundation...\Apache2.2\bin 键入命令: ab -n 800 -c 800 http://192.168.0.10/ (-n发出800个请求,-c模拟800并发,相当800人同时访问,后面是测试url)

1.7K30

Apache自带压力测试工具——AB初体验

http://www.linuxidc.com/Linux/2015-02/113430.htm】上看到了他介绍这款Apache自带压力测试工具AB,十分喜爱,于是今天终于有机会体验下ab对网站压力测试...实验之前我apache已经安装了,操作系统:Ubuntu 10.04 VMware 7.0 1、先查看一下版本信息 ab -V(注意是大写V) 01.linuxidc@linuxidc:~$ ab...Software Foundation, http://www.apache.org/   2、我们也可以使用小写v查看下ab命令一些属性 ab -v 01.linuxidc@linuxidc:~...$ ab -v  02.ab: option requires an argument -- v  03.ab: wrong number of arguments  04.Usage: ab [...-f protocol    Specify SSL/TLS protocol (SSL2, SSL3, TLS1, or ALL)  3、现在我们就对88181网站进行一次压力测试吧,使用命令ab

47910

Apache自带ab压力测试工具使用教程

abapache自带压力测试工具,ab是apachebench命令缩写。...当安装完apache时候,就可以在bin下面找到ab.exe然后进行apache 负载压力测试 1.cd到apachebin目录下 2.测试ab工具是否可用,输入:ab -V,如图提示相应版本...,说明可以正常使用 3.使用ab对网站进行测试,示例 ab -n 10000 -c 100 http://www.baidu.com/s //注意,需要在域名后加上/path 参数说明 -n :...总共请求执行数,缺省是1 -c : 并发数,缺省是1 -t : 测试所进行总时间,秒为单位,缺省50000s -p : POST时数据文件 文件格式如"p1=1&p2=2".使用方法是 -p 111...-w : 以HTML表格式输出此次ab测试结果 -v : 设置显示信息详细程度 -V : 打印版本号并退出 -h : 显示用法信息,其实就是ab -help。

76030

网站性能压力测试工具:Apache ab使用详解

abApache自带压力测试工具。ab非常实用,它不仅可以对Apache服务器进行网站访问压力测试,也可以对其它类型服务器进行压力测试。比如Nginx、Tomcat、IIS等。...下面我们开始介绍有关ab命令使用: 1、ab原理 2、ab安装 3、ab参数说明 4、ab性能指标 5、ab实际使用 一、ab原理 ab是apachebench命令缩写。...ab原理:ab命令会创建多个并发访问线程,模拟多个访问者同时对某一URL地址进行访问。...它测试目标是基于URL,因此,它既可以用来测试apache负载压力,也可以测试nginx、lighthttp、tomcat、IIS等其它Web服务器压力。...我们现在就来测试apache性能。

2.8K10
领券